How to Pack 14 Days of Outfits Into One Bag
The idea of fitting two weeks of clothing into one bag sounds impossible until you understand that you are not packing fourteen separate outfits. You are packing a small collection of pieces that work together in multiple combinations.
The math works like this. If you pack four tops, three bottoms, one dress or one versatile layer, and one nicer outfit option, you have more than enough combinations to cover fourteen days without repeating the exact same look. Add in the fact that most trips involve at least one opportunity to do laundry, and you have even more flexibility.
The key is choosing pieces that genuinely mix and match with each other. Every top should work with every bottom you bring. Every bottom should feel at home with at least two of your tops. When you are shopping or pulling things from your closet, hold them up next to each other. If they do not work together, one of them does not make the cut.
Neutral colors are your best friend here. Navy, white, black, olive, and tan all play well together and do not clash. A few pieces in a color you love are fine, but building around neutrals gives you the most combination options with the fewest items.
How to pack properly cwbiancavoyage also means being ruthless about cutting items that only work in one specific scenario. If you can only picture wearing something for one particular occasion and nothing else, leave it home.
Building a Carry-On Wardrobe for a Long Trip
Traveling with only a carry-on for two weeks is not for everyone, but it is more achievable than most people think, and it makes the whole trip noticeably easier. No checked bag fees, no waiting at baggage claim, and no risk of your suitcase ending up in the wrong city.
The foundation of a carry-on wardrobe for a long trip is fabric choice. Lightweight, wrinkle-resistant fabrics that pack down small are non-negotiable. Merino wool is the gold standard for travel tops because it regulates temperature, resists odor, and can be worn multiple days in a row without issue. Nylon and polyester travel blends work well for pants and bottoms for the same reasons.
Heavy denim, thick cotton, and structured blazers take up too much room and weigh too much for a carry-on-only approach. If you want a denim look, lightweight stretch denim or a denim-look travel pant works much better.
Roll your clothes instead of folding them. Rolling reduces wrinkles, compresses items, and makes it easier to see everything in your bag at a glance. Packing cubes help even more. Use one cube for tops, one for bottoms, and one for underwear and socks. This system is central to how to pack properly cwbiancavoyage and makes unpacking and repacking throughout a long trip much faster.
Wear your bulkiest items on travel days. Jeans, boots, and a heavier layer worn onto the plane free up significant space in your bag for everything else.
How to Plan Outfits That Work for Multiple Occasions
A two-week trip usually involves a range of situations. Casual days of sightseeing, a nicer dinner or two, possibly a beach day, maybe a day of hiking or a lot of walking. Planning outfits that can transition between these scenarios without requiring entirely different clothing sets is one of the most practical how to pack properly cwbiancavoyage strategies there is.
Think about each item in terms of how many occasions it can serve. A linen button-down shirt works for a casual sightseeing day, can be dressed up slightly for dinner with the right pants, and can even work as a light layer on a beach day over a swimsuit. That is three uses from one item.
A simple wrap dress or a pair of tailored shorts can move from daytime exploring to an evening out with a change of shoes and a small bag. Shoes are often what actually shift an outfit from casual to dressed up, so choosing footwear that covers a range is important.
Plan at least one outfit that genuinely works for a nicer occasion. You do not need to bring formal wear, but having one option that goes beyond casual means you are covered if the trip calls for it without having to scramble or buy something last minute.
Putting together a travel outfit formula before you pack is one of those practical strategies that saves real time when you are getting ready each morning and helps you make sure every item you packed actually gets used.
The Best Bag Size for a Two-Week International Trip
Bag size is a decision that affects your entire trip, and getting it wrong in either direction causes problems. Too small and you are cramming things in and leaving necessities behind. Too large and you are checking a bag, paying fees, and hauling something heavy through every transit connection.
For a two-week trip, a checked bag in the medium range, around twenty-five to twenty-seven inches, is the sweet spot for most travelers who are not committed to carry-on only. It holds enough for two weeks of clothing, toiletries, and a few extras without being so large that it becomes unwieldy.
If you are going carry-on only, a forty to forty-five liter bag is the practical maximum that fits in most international overhead bins. Some budget airlines in Europe have stricter size limits, so check the specific airline's policy before you commit to a bag size.
Hard-shell suitcases protect your belongings better and are easier to clean. Soft-shell bags are slightly more flexible with space and lighter overall. Both work well for long trips. The more important factors are the quality of the wheels, the durability of the zippers, and whether the bag has a compression system inside to keep things from shifting.
How to pack properly cwbiancavoyage for international travel also means considering the weight limits for your specific flights. Most international carriers allow around fifty pounds for checked bags, but budget carriers in Europe and elsewhere often have much lower limits. Check before you pack and weigh your bag at home before you leave.
